Industrial Building Painting in Boulder, CO
Industrial building painting services encompass the application of durable, protective coatings to large-scale structures such as warehouses, manufacturing facilities, and storage tanks. These projects often involve extensive surface preparation and the use of specialized paints design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ions, chemical exposure, and heavy use. Property owners typically seek this service to enhance the longevity of their structures, improve safety, and maintain a professional appearance for their industrial or commercial spaces.
Before requesting industrial building painting, property owners should consider the size and type of surfaces involved, as well as any specific environmental or safety requirements. It is important to understand the scope of surface preparation needed, including cleaning, sanding, or repairs, and to clarify the types of coatings suitable for the project. Additionally, knowing the impact of weather conditions and the need for minimal disruption during the work can help in planning the project effectively.

Common Industrial Building Painting Jobs
Industrial building painting services include coating warehouses and manufacturing facilities to protect surfaces and improve appearance.
Exterior painting of large industrial structures helps withstand weather exposure and prolongs the lifespan of the building.
Interior painting projects focus on surfaces like storage areas, workshops, and production spaces for a clean, professional look.
Specialized coatings are applied to industrial surfaces to resist chemicals, corrosion, and heavy wear.
Painting of loading docks, railings, and other exterior metalwork enhances safety and durability.
Industrial painting services also include surface preparation to ensure long-lasting adhesion and finish quality.
Industrial Building Painting Questions
What types of industrial buildings can be painted? Industrial painting services typically cover war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age tanks, and distribution centers.
Is surface preparation important before painting? Yes, proper cleaning and surface prep ensure the paint adheres well and provides lasting protection.
What paint finishes are suitable for industrial buildings? Durable, high-performance finishes like epoxy or alkyd paints are common choices for industrial environments.
How often should industrial building exteriors be repainted? Repainting intervals depend on exposure and conditions, but generally every 10-15 years is recommended for optimal maintenance.
